Abstract
This chapter presents examples of GREBE’s legal analysis. The first section continues the analysis of Jarek’s Case, which was begun in Chapter 4. The second section sets forth GREBE’s analysis of four closely related cases, illustrating how small changes in facts can yield significant differences in analysis. Appendix B contains a brief summary of the precedent cases used by GREBE in the analyses of these cases.
